Problem

Conventional DRX cycle determination methods for terminal devices in IoT communication networks often result in power waste or fail to meet specific paging requirements, leading to longer latency or overlapping between DRX cycles and paging Common Search Space (CSS) durations, which affects communication efficiency and latency.

Innovation Solution

A method where terminal devices receive DRX information from network devices, determining a target DRX cycle based on a combination of their specific DRX cycle and the minimum DRX cycle associated with the paging carrier, to avoid overlapping and meet diverse communication requirements.

AI summary

Embodiments of the present disclosure relate to methods, devices and computer readable media for communication. According to embodiments of the present disclosure, a terminal device receives, from a network device, a list of minimum discontinuous reception (DRX) cycles associated with a plurality of paging carriers. The terminal device selects a paging carrier from the plurality of paging carriers. The terminal device determines a DRX cycle based on at least one of a DRX cycle specific to the terminal device and a minimum DRX cycle associated with the paging carrier in the list of minimum DRX cycles.
